These braces are an orthodontic system with clear ceramic brackets and tooth-colored wires shaded to match your natural teeth.
It’s important to note that clear braces are fitted onto your teeth for the duration of treatment. They are not removable like clear aligners. The brackets are bonded onto the outer tooth surfaces, and an archwire is connected to the brackets. Elastics or ligatures are used to keep the wire in place.
With clear braces, you may not necessarily need ligatures or elastics. Some systems, like Damon braces, are self-ligating.

Clear braces can offer a couple of important advantages outlined below.
Clear braces are less noticeable than metal braces, although they are still visible in your mouth. The brackets and wires are designed to blend in with your teeth.
Systems like Damon clear braces can be equally as effective as metal braces. Because they are permanently fitted onto your teeth during treatment, they work continuously to straighten them.
Fixed braces can provide extremely precise tooth movements and provide excellent treatment outcomes.
Any orthodontic treatment has its downsides, and clear braces are no different. Some potential disadvantages are outlined below.
All fixed braces require additional oral care as you must take the time to clean around brackets and wires thoroughly and brush your teeth after every single meal.
Tools are available to help with this task, and although oral care may take longer, it’s only for the duration of treatment.
The clear brace brackets can become stained, especially if you like your coffee, tea, or red wine and consume a lot of dark-colored foods. A good oral care routine can help minimize this risk. It also helps not to smoke.
Even if the brace brackets become stained, they can be replaced during your treatment, so this shouldn’t deter you from choosing clear braces.
When wearing fixed braces, you need to change your diet, just as you would with traditional metal braces. Foods to avoid are those that could damage the brackets or wires or are very sticky and difficult to remove.
As mentioned earlier, Damon braces are a clear brace system that works slightly differently. Instead of requiring elastic ties or ligatures to hold archwires in place, Damon brace brackets are self-ligating.
The patented brace bracket has a slide mechanism, allowing the archwire to be connected to the bracket while still allowing it to move freely.
Damon braces are designed to create a wider and more beautiful smile and eliminate dark areas at the corners of your mouth.

Metal braces remain a proven way to straighten teeth, but clear braces are increasingly popular among adults. Clear braces work the same way as traditional metal braces, but there are some differences listed below.
Clear braces are much more discreet compared with metal braces.
Clear braces aren’t as strong as metal braces, and the brackets are more likely to break or fracture. Therefore, treatment can take a little longer to complete with clear braces since lower forces are applied to help prevent breakages.
Clear braces cost more than metal braces. If you have dental insurance, it may cover a lower percentage of the costs than metal braces.
Clear ceramic braces can be an excellent option if you are interested in teeth straightening. They provide similar results to metal braces except far more discreetly.
Clear braces can be a great choice if you have more complex bite problems and need the kind of precise tooth movements that can sometimes only be achieved with fixed braces.
It’s important to remember that clear braces are different from clear aligners. Unlike aligners such as Invisalign, clear braces for adults are firmly bonded to their teeth for the duration of treatment.
